〜「Selenide」を用いた実践的なWebテストのハンズオン〜
コースコード | SH012 | 期間 | 1日間 | 時間 | 10:00~17:00 | 価格 | \46,200(税込) | 主催 | 株式会社SHIFT |
---|
コースコード | SH012 | 期間 | 1日間 | 時間 | 10:00~17:00 |
---|---|---|---|---|---|
価格 | \46,200(税込) | 主催 | 株式会社SHIFT |
コースコード | SH012 | ||
---|---|---|---|
期間 | 1日間 | ||
時間 | 10:00~17:00 | ||
価格 | \46,200(税込) | ||
主催 | 株式会社SHIFT |
★テスト自動化の総合演習版!★
本講座では、品質保証の「方法論」の一つである「テスト自動化」を学びます。
ソフトウェアテスト専門会社SHIFTが、成功するテスト自動化へのステップとその魅力をお伝えします!
「テスト自動化」はここ数年、非常に盛り上がっているキーワードの一つであり、世の中には数多くの自動化ツールが出回っています。
この講座では、GUI自動テストOSSの代表格である Selenideについて、演習を中心に使い方を学びます。
Selenideは簡潔で書きやすいAPIを提供し、環境構築も簡単に行うことができます。
本講座は、「テスト自動化入門」の上級講座で、自動化ツールの実践講座となります。
テスト自動化の基礎を学び、「Selenide」を用いたテストの作成、具体的なシナリオの作成、テストコードの保守性を上げるためのPageObjectデザインパターンの使い方を身につけます。
※Javaでテストスクリプトを書くため、初級程度のプログラミング経験が必要です。
・Selenideを使ってテスト自動化ができる
・状況に応じて技術の使い分けができる
・保守性のよいテストコード、テストスクリプトを書ける
・自動テストに興味があり、基本的な知識はあるが実務で活用できていない方
・テスト自動化に本格的に取り組めていないものの、導入を前向きにご検討されている方
・CI(継続的インテグレーション)を始めたいと思っている方
・初級程度のプログラミング経験がある方(Javaでテストスクリプトを書くため)
※アノテーションの書き方を理解しているのが望ましい
■本講座ではリモートデスクトップを利用した演習を行うため、オンライン参加の場合、30分ごとに再接続が必要になるなど少々制約が発生いたします。
そのため、東京近郊にお住まいの方には会場参加を推奨いたします。
お住まいの地域、その他の事情によりオンライン参加をご希望の方は、若干ご不便をおかけいたしますが、下記「オンライン受講にあたって」の10ページ(ハンズオン環境について)で環境等をご確認の上、お申し込みください。
https://huniv.cdn.shiftinc.jp/assets/doc/online_caution.pdf
<オンラインクラスにご参加の方へ>
・「Zoom」を使用いたします。
・テキストおよび演習資料はオンラインストレージ「DirectCloud-BOX」にて配布いたします。
・Excelが編集できるPCをご準備ください。
・サブディスプレイの利用を推奨します。
・オンライン参加時の注意事項(下記URL)を事前にご確認ください。
https://huniv.cdn.shiftinc.jp/assets/doc/online_caution.pdf
・Zoomのシステム要件は下記URLをご参照ください。
https://support.zoom.us/hc/ja/articles/201362023-System-Requirements-for-PC-Mac-and-Linux
●1.テスト自動化とは
・テスト自動化入門ふりかえり
・テスト自動化 Next Step
●2.Selenideハンズオン
・環境確認
・Selenium IDEからの移行
・PageObject
●3.Selenide演習
・自動テスト作成演習
※内容は変更になる場合もあります。